About The Charles Schwab Corporation

The Charles Schwab Corporation (SCHW) operates in the Financial Services sector, specifically in Capital Markets. With a market capitalization of about $151.91B, it ranks as a large-cap stock — a major established company.

Shares recently traded near $87.35, within a 52-week range of $83.96 to $107.50 (-18.7% from the high, +4.0% from the low). Beta of 0.80 indicates relatively lower volatility versus the market.

Trailing profit margin is about 38.0%, signaling a strong profit margin relative to many peers.

Understanding This Metric

Market capitalization sums the market value of all outstanding shares. It helps classify The Charles Schwab Corporation by size — mega-cap, large-cap, and mid-cap stocks tend to have different liquidity, volatility, and index inclusion profiles. Size alone does not determine quality, but it frames risk and how widely the stock is held.

Is SCHW a mega/large/mid/small cap?

With roughly $151.91B in market cap, The Charles Schwab Corporation falls in the large-cap category in our size buckets (mega ≥$200B, large ≥$10B, mid ≥$2B). Size affects liquidity, index weight, and typical volatility.

How does market cap relate to SCHW's risk profile?

Larger caps tend to have broader analyst coverage and deeper trading; smaller caps can offer growth but with higher idiosyncratic risk. Use market cap together with debt, cash flow, and Financial Services position — not alone.
